Imports of 230 electronics products, mostly China made, delayed pending quality clearances
New Delhi: Imports of close to 230 models of mobile phones, laptops, notebooks, tablets, smartwatches and earphones from the likes of Apple, Samsung, Xiaomi, LG, Oppo, Tecno, Lenovo, Acer, Dell, Toshiba and HP – all mainly made in China – have been delayed, pending approval from India’s quality control body for more than 20 days.
According to data from the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S), some of the applications for import of these models being manufactured in China are pending even from September. As per industry estimates, this could be delaying import of over 500 million units of these devices in the high sell-in festive season.
